The AT24C128BW-SH-T is based on EEPROM technology, which allows for non-volatile storage of data. It utilizes an I2C interface for communication with the host device. The memory cells in the IC can be electrically programmed and erased, allowing data to be written and modified as needed. The stored data remains intact even when power is removed from the device.

Q: What is AT24C128BW-SH-T? A: AT24C128BW-SH-T is a serial EEPROM (Electrically Erasable Programmable Read-Only Memory) chip with a capacity of 128 kilobits (16 kilobytes). It is commonly used for storing small amounts of non-volatile data in various electronic devices.
Q: What is the operating voltage range of AT24C128BW-SH-T? A: The operating voltage range of AT24C128BW-SH-T is typically between 1.7V and 5.5V, making it compatible with a wide range of systems.
Q: How does AT24C128BW-SH-T communicate with other devices? A: AT24C128BW-SH-T uses the I2C (Inter-Integrated Circuit) protocol for communication. It has a 2-wire serial interface consisting of a data line (SDA) and a clock line (SCL).
Q: What is the maximum clock frequency supported by AT24C128BW-SH-T? A: AT24C128BW-SH-T supports a maximum clock frequency of 1 MHz, allowing for fast data transfer rates.
Q: Can AT24C128BW-SH-T be used in automotive applications? A: Yes, AT24C128BW-SH-T is designed to meet the requirements of automotive applications, including extended temperature ranges and high reliability.
Q: How many write cycles can AT24C128BW-SH-T endure? A: AT24C128BW-SH-T can endure up to 1 million write cycles, making it suitable for applications that require frequent data updates.
Q: Does AT24C128BW-SH-T have built-in write protection? A: Yes, AT24C128BW-SH-T has a built-in write protection feature that allows you to protect specific memory blocks from being overwritten.
Q: What is the typical data retention time of AT24C128BW-SH-T? A: The typical data retention time of AT24C128BW-SH-T is 100 years, ensuring long-term storage of critical information.
Q: Can multiple AT24C128BW-SH-T chips be connected in a single system? A: Yes, multiple AT24C128BW-SH-T chips can be connected in a system using different I2C addresses, allowing for expanded storage capacity.
